This cairn stands in a small memorial area near the camp store not far from the museum. The 4-sided cairn is built of local rock blocks and stands about 6 feet tall. It features two metal plaques which read as follows:
[E side]
"In Memory of
ED NELSON
Park Superintendent
1970-1990
Tannehill is his monument"
[S side]
DEDICATION
This memorial is respectively dedicated to state senators E. W. Skidmore of Tuscaloosa and E. H. Gilmore, Jr. of McCalla whose foresight and concern, in cooperation with the Alabama Central district of civic time international, led to the state ordered preservation of the historic Tannehill furnaces.
Chief sponsors of legislation setting this area aside as a state historic site, Sens. Skidmore and Gilmore deserve the thanks and appreciation of all Alabamians who cherish Alabama's rich heritage and believe that only through reflection on the past can we build a better future.
THE TANNEHILL FURNACE AND FOUNDRY COMMISSION
S.748 (Skidmore, Gilmore, Morrow, Vacca, Bailes, Hawkins, Dominick, Givhan, McCarley, and Childs)
Passed by the Alabama legislature as Act No. 994, September 12, 1969."
[N Side]
"TANNEHILL FURNACE AND FOUNDRY COMMISSION
The Alabama legislature, passing Act No. 994 on September 12, 1969, created the 16-member Tannehill furnace and foundry commission as a state agency to preserve and restore and promote as the state park the land and relics surrounding the historic Tannehill furnaces.
Original appointments made by Gov. Albert Brewer on February 6, 1970 included:
S. E. Belcher, Jr.
James R. Bennett
Tunstall R. Gray
Dorothy Henry
Dan Kilgo
J. E. Lewis
Sam Maury
Jim Oakley, Sr.
W. L. Russell
A. D. Schwarzkopf
Margaret D. Sizemore
R. E. Smith
H. A. Snow
J. Dudley West
Representing the University of Alabama and the Alabama Historical Commission
Dr. Walter B Jones
Dr. Charles G. Summersell"
